Machine washable: It means that the crepe fabric can be machine washed. Use a gentle cycle with cool or lukewarm water, and a mild detergent. Avoid using bleach or fabric softeners.
-
Do not bleach: This means that you should not use any bleach or harsh chemicals on the crepe fabric, as they can damage the material.
-
Do not tumble dry: This means that you should not put the crepe fabric in a dryer. Instead, lay it flat to dry or hang it up to air dry. Avoid direct sunlight or heat sources, as they can cause the fabric to fade or shrink.
-
Iron at a low temperature: If the crepe fabric must be ironed, use a low temperature and steam setting. Place a cloth between the iron and the fabric to prevent any direct contact. Iron on the wrong side of the fabric to avoid damaging the surface
-
Hand wash only: It means that the crepe fabric should be washed by hand. Use cool or lukewarm water and a mild detergent. Gently swish the fabric around in the water, then rinse thoroughly. Do not wring or twist the fabric, as this can cause it to lose its shape.
Remember to always check the care label on your crepe item for specific care instructions, as these may vary depending on the type of fabric and any additional materials used. It's also a good idea to test any cleaning or care products on a small, inconspicuous area first before applying them to the entire item.
